Description
The Plena tabletop microphone is a stylish, highquality tabletop unidirectional condenser microphone, mainly intended for making calls in a public address
system. Its heavy metal base and rubber feet ensure stability on any flat surface. The special design also allows the unit to be neatly flush-mounted in desktops.
- Stylish tabletop unidirectional condenser microphone on a flexible stem
- Phantom powered by amplifier
- Momentary or toggle PTT-key for calls with priority contact
- Green LED, indicating microphone active
- Stable metal base design with fixed 2 m cable and lockable DIN connector
- Separate DIN to XLR adapter
Specification
Electrical | |
Phantom power supply | |
Voltage range | 12 to 48 V |
Current consumption | <8 mA |
Performance | |
Sensitivity | 0.7 mV @ 85 dB SPL (2 mV/Pa) |
Maximum input sound level | 110 dB SPL |
Distortion | <0.6% (maximum input) |
Input noise level (equiv.) | 28 dB SPLA (S/N 66 dBA ref. 1 Pa) |
Frequency response | 100 Hz to 16 kHz |
Output impedance | 200 ohm |
Mechanical | |
Base dimensions (H x W x D) | 40 x 100 x 235 mm (1.57 x 3.97 x 9.25 in) |
Weight Approx. | 1 kg (2.2 lb) |
Color | Charcoal with silver |
Stem length with mic | 390 mm (15.35 in) |
Cable length | 2 m (6.56 ft) |
